On Tuesday 14 April, we are hosting a tasting evening where food, curiosity and science come together. Enjoy a selection of delicious tapas while discovering how and why we make certain food choices. 

Through playful taste tests and interactive questions, you will explore the connection between taste, health and sustainability. Taste, test, and uncover the story behind your choices.

Food researcher Leonie Barelds from the Louis Bolk Institute, where she studies healthy and sustainable food choices, will guide the evening and share her insights while you taste and explore the dishes yourself. Expect an inspiring evening filled with good food, conversation, and new discoveries.
